Introducing IMMA: An Injection Moulding Machine Adapter that Simplifies Cobot Automation for Plastics Manufacturers
2026.07.09 News

The new adapter enables fast, standardized integration between collaborative robots and injection moulding machines, helping manufacturers automate with lower costs, shorterdeployment times, and greater flexibility.

 

Fürth, Germany – July 8th 2026 – JAKA Robotics, a global manufacturer of collaborative robots, today announced the launch of IMMA (Injection Moulding Machine Adapter), a standardized interface designed specifically for injection moulding applications. Built around the EUROMAP 67 communication standard, IMMA enables plastics manufacturers to integrate JAKA collaborative robots with injection moulding machines quickly, safely, and with significantly reduced engineering effort. 

 

As plastics manufacturers face increasing labour shortages, shorter production runs, rising costs, and growing demands for production flexibility, automation has become a necessity. However, traditional automation solutions often require extensive integration work, dedicated industrial robots, and complex safety systems that increase project costs and deployment times. 

 

JAKA's new IMMA addresses these challenges by providing a plug-and-play interface between collaborative robots and injection moulding machines, making robotic machine tending more accessible than ever.

Designed for Fast Deployment 

 

The JAKA IMMA combines pre-configured signal mapping, robot and machine synchronization, integrated safety outputs, and simplified wiring into one compact module. Together with a pre-configured robot program, manufacturers can significantly reduce engineering work and accelerate implementation. 

 

The system supports: 

 

  • Standardized communication via EUROMAP 67 
  • Plug-and-play wiring 
  • Pre-configured robot and injection moulding machine communication 
  • Simplified electrical integration 
  • Ready-to-use machine tending programs 
  • Compatibility with standard or custom end-of-arm tooling 

 

This standardized approach enables deployment in less than six hours under typical installation conditions, reducing downtime and minimizing disruption to production. 

 

Lowering the Barrier to Automation 

 

Unlike conventional industrial robot installations that often require large safety fences and extensive engineering, IMMA has been designed specifically for collaborative robot deployments. 

 

The solution helps manufacturers: 

 

  • Reduce integration costs 
  • Minimize safety hardware requirements 
  • Improve operator flexibility 
  • Reduce dependence on manual labour 
  • Increase machine uptime 
  • Standardize automation across multiple production lines and factory locations 

 

For many small and medium-tonnage injection moulding machines operating with medium cycle times, the solution can deliver a return on investment in less than 12 months. 

 

Built for the Modern Plastics Industry 

 

The IMMA solution is particularly suited for plastics manufacturers looking to automate part removal, machine tending, insert loading, or other repetitive handling tasks while maintaining production flexibility. 

 

By leveraging collaborative robot technology, manufacturers can continue operating in environments where floor space is limited and production requirements change frequently—without the complexity typically associated with industrial robot automation. 

 

The solution complies with relevant industry standards including EUROMAP 67ISO 10218ISO 13849, and ISO/TS 15066, supporting safe human-robot collaboration while protecting both operators and equipment.
